South Dakota Cost of Living Index

South Dakota's Regional Price Parity (RPP) is 88.0, meaning prices are 12.0% lower the national average. A Forging Machine Setters, Operators, and Tenders, Metal and Plastic earning $45,430 in South Dakota has the equivalent purchasing power of $51,625 in an average-cost US state.

What are Regional Price Parities (RPP)?

Regional Price Parities (RPPs) are price indexes published by the U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is (BEA) that measure differences in price levels across states. They are expressed as a percentage of the national average (US = 100). Higher RPP means higher cost of living.

How is the cost-of-living adjusted salary calculated?

The adjusted salary is calculated as: Nominal Salary x (100 / RPP). For a Forging Machine Setters, Operators, and Tenders, Metal and Plastic in South Dakota: $45,430 x (100 / 88.0) = $51,625. This represents what the salary would be worth in a state with average living costs.
